Kathmandu. Samrat Cement Company’s business has declined. The company’s business declined by 48.52 percent in 2024 compared to 2023.
The company has a turnover of Rs 1.77 billion in 2024 and Rs 3.37 billion in 2023.
Similarly, the company had a turnover of Rs 4.87 billion in 2022. Looking at the business situation of the company, there is a decline in turnover every year.
Established in 2013, the company has been producing cement at a capacity of 3,600 metric tonnes. In addition, the company has been operating a limestone industry with a capacity of 4,000 metric tons. The Dang-based company has been selling OPC and PPC cement under Gajraj, Gajraj Premium, Baz, Baz Premium, Badshah, Samrat and Samrat Premium brands.
The company has been rated at Rs 10.14 billion for long-term loans and Rs 2.35 billion for short-term loans. Anil Kumar Rungta is the chairman of the company.
